Erigo23: Welcome. 1) evaluate only your masters degree with WES 2) your wife should evaluate both her degrees so as to give her 2 or more degrees which is higher than just bsc 3) both of you write IELTS and try your hardest to max out LRSW 8.5,8,8,7.5 to increase your chances cuz the regular 8,7,7,7 isn’t working this year try to max out in at least 2 subjects 4) Someone has to be the PA which would have been you since you have 3 years it helps to increase your scores also but if you are above 30 then you lose 5 points 5) however if your wife is below 30 she can be the PA and if her 2 years experience excludes NYSC she can add NYSC to make 3 years and viola!! you are ready. Afra88: Welcome.
Age is a main factor so you can play around with the CRS calculator assuming an IELTs score of 8777; Then also depending on your NOCs, you can check against some of the provinces that pick directly from the pool like - Ontario, Alberta etc to see what your chances are.
These two can help you decide who has a better chance at being the PA.
Once you have your Ielts results you can decide if maximum points CLB10 will be best or if you need to consider French or PNP.
